1. General Overview
The Circular Safety Pod (Model: SC-3000) is a modular emergency protection device designed with high-strength composite materials and a biomimetic structure, specifically developed for life-support needs in extreme environments (e.g., natural disasters, biochemical leaks, space exploration, etc.). Its spherical structure adheres to the minimal surface-area-to-volume ratio.principle, offering optimal pressure resistance and space utilization. It has been certified under ISO 22301:2024 safety standards.

1.Structural Advantages: It adopts a spherical design, which performs excellently in compression and impact resistance. It can effectively protect the personnel and equipment inside the cabin from high pressure in deep sea or collision and impact in complex terrain in the wild. The spherical structure also has high space utilization efficiency. With a limited external size, the interior can realize reasonable functional zoning, such as the driving area and material storage area.
2.Functional Integration Advantages: It integrates multiple functions such as communication, monitoring, and life support. The equipment such as cameras and satellite antennas on the top enable it to have good environmental observation and long-distance communication capabilities, which can transmit data in real time and keep in touch with the outside world. The material storage and life support systems inside the cabin can ensure the survival and work needs of personnel in extreme environments.
3.Mobility and Adaptability Advantages: It has good environmental adaptability and can operate stably in various extreme environments such as polar regions, deep seas, and wild areas.
